当前位置:编程学习 > C#/ASP.NET >>

如何debug命令行程序( C# )

常用的2种方法:

方法1

在Main()函数刚开始,加入如下代码:


1 static int Main(string[] args)
2 {
3
4 Console.In.ReadLine();
5
6 ...
7
8 }
 

这样能让程序在此停住,等待输入。此时便可以在VS中attach上该程序,开始debug。

此方法在需要debug各种参数时比较方便。

 

方法2

直接在VS中打开project properties,在debug->Command line arguments中输入你的命令行参数。然后直接F5。

此方法因为每次对不同参数,需要去改project properties,所以在参数固定时,比较常用。

 

 

摘自 breakout

补充:软件开发 , C# ,
CopyRight © 2022 站长资源库 编程知识问答 zzzyk.com All Rights Reserved
部分文章来自网络,